Keep your layout consistent.
Layout features help to organize content and create an effective presentation, but you don’t want to clutter it with multiple layouts. According to PowerPoint Experts, your layout should be consistent throughout the presentation to help the audience follow along. Headings, fonts, and colors can create a hierarchy and emphasize important information. Alignment and spacing can also control how the information is presented. Placing all of the text in a central column or leaving too much space between lines can make your presentation difficult to read. It is important to use these features wisely so the audience can easily understand and follow the message.
When choosing fonts and other features, make sure you choose something readable and adequately-sized. For example, a cursive font that’s too small to read will end up confusing your audience. Instead, choose a large size for your font and pick a reliably easy font to read, like Times New Roman. Any Serif or Sans Serif font is typically safe when it comes to readability. Also, make sure you don’t choose a layout template that’s too distracting. Distracting layouts with busy designs will detract from the message you’re trying to convey in your presentation.
Create a master slide.
A slide master is a template in a presentation that contains the layout and formatting for all the slides. Each slide in the presentation is based on the slide master and can contain text, graphics, and formatting elements that are common to all the slides in the presentation. You can use the slide master to create different slide layouts, change the font, or add special effects. This layout can also include a title area, a body area, and a footer. Using this template is a great way to keep your layouts consistent. To create a slide master:
- Open the presentation that you want to create a slide master for.
- On the View tab, in the Master Views group, click Slide Master.
- The Slide Master view will open.
- In the Slide Master view, you can add text and graphics to the slide master.
- When you are finished adding text and graphics, close the Slide Master view.
- The new slide master will be added to the presentation.
Add content to your slides.
When creating a presentation, you may want to add content to your slides. You can create a compelling presentation that engages your audience with images, audio, videos, and other content. One way to add content to your slides is by using text boxes. You can insert a text box by clicking on the Insert tab and selecting “Text Box.” Once you have inserted a text box, you can type in your content. Another way to add content is by using shapes. You can insert a shape by clicking on the Insert tab and selecting “Shapes.” Once you have inserted a shape, you can resize it and then type in your content.
You can also add images to your slides to visually convey a point. To do this, click on the Insert tab and select “Pictures.” After you have chosen pictures, you can resize them and place them where you want them on the slide. Adding charts to your slides helps illustrate your data or ideas. To do this, click on the Insert tab and select “Chart.” Once you have chosen a chart type, you can enter your data points.
